The prognostic impact of circulating homeobox A9 methylated DNA in advanced non-small cell lung cancer
1 Feb 2021
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: The homeobox A9 gene encodes a transcription factor, and aberrantly methylated homeobox A9 in the circulation has been suggested as a prognostic marker in early stage non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). The aim of the present study was to investigate the prognostic impact of methylated homeobox A9 in plasma from patients with advanced NSCLC.
